Direct Link to St. Benny's profile

St. Benny

St. Benny

76561197977902846

ADDITIONAL INFO
  • LEVEL 23
  • DOES NOT OWN DOTA2

St. Benny

76561197977902846

St. Benny
ADDITIONAL INFO
  • LEVEL 23
  • DOES NOT OWN DOTA2

$994.14

Last updated September 2021

$994.14